Serenity Forge Releases Two Lisa Trilogy Games on Android

Serenity Forge has brought the emotional rollercoaster of The Lisa Trilogy to Android with the release of Lisa: The Painful and Lisa: The Joyful. If you've experienced these games on PC, you're familiar with the intense journey they offer. For newcomers or those yet to explore these titles, here's a quick dive into what awaits you.

It’s Painful and Joyful at the Same Time

The Lisa series began with Lisa: The First in 2012, a retro-style exploration game that plunges players into the psyche of Lisa Armstrong. You navigate a distorted reality shaped by trauma, piecing together fragmented memories, encountering odd characters, and uncovering the past through VHS tapes. It's a surreal experience that subtly plays with your mind.

Following the initial release, Lisa: The Painful and Lisa: The Joyful hit PC in 2014 and 2015, respectively. Now, fans can enjoy the Definitive Editions of these games on Android, following updates to the PC versions in July 2023.

You Can Play The Lisa Trilogy on Android

In Lisa: The Painful, you step into the shoes of Brad Armstrong, navigating the desolate wasteland of Olathe in search of his adopted daughter, Buddy. The game blends brutality and humor, with your choices having lasting impacts—losing limbs, sacrificing party members, or taking hits for others.

Lisa: The Joyful concludes the trilogy, where you play as Buddy in a darker, post-White Flash Olathe, a world where she's the only woman left. Struggling to survive and seeking vengeance while concealing her identity, you'll face even tougher decisions that can drastically alter your journey.

The Definitive Editions enhance the experience with updated battle systems, six new Warlord skills, new border art, a music player, and a 'painless' mode for a more accessible playthrough.
